The All New, Allen MSP 415 riding trowel is powerful enough for tough panning and fast enough for final finishing of concrete. The MSP 415 Rider is powerful, responsive, dependable, and value priced. With the use of the 35hp Vanguard Air-Cooled Engine and a centrifugal clutch, the MSP 415 delivers power through its Super Heavy Duty (SHD) gear boxes to two 46” diameter non-overlapping rotors. This new rider is just what today’s concrete contractors ordered. The MSP 415 is the latest addition to Allen’s Mechanical Super Pro Series of Riders. |

The Allen HDX 740 is a totally new All Hydraulic-Powered Riding Trowel. Packed with the punch of a 60HP Cummins Turbo Diesel, the HDX 740 is one of the most powerful and dependable riders on the market today. The low weight to horsepower ratio and reliable hydraulic components (including a patent pending automatic load sensing device) ensures a peak “on the concrete” performance every time. The HDX 740 is the second in the new series of Hydra-Drive Extreme (HDX) Allen(R) Riders. |
